hi all,
Im just getting to grips with my first corn snake which ive now had for 2-3 months.No problems so far touch wood.I was just wondering as my snake is showing now signs of shedding how long it usually takes or length of time in between sheds?Also does 2 fuzzies every week for a 1yr old corn length of 2-2 and a half ft sound okay for amout of feed. Any help much appreciated thanks..
 
I don't know how much to feed a i year old. Mine is only 5 months old. But for a 1 year old snake it would shed onec ever month or every two months. I hope that helps.
 
I feed many of my yearlings 2 fuzzies per week. However, each snake is different. Keep the food items 1 to 1 1/2 times the diameter of your snake and you should be fine.

Shedding is mostly a function of growth. When they are young, corns will shed on average every 3-5 weeks. Remember that at a young age they are converting up to 30% of their food intake into new growth. But again every one is different. I have a yearling male that hasn't shed in 2 months, but is eating on the same feeding schedule as the ones that are shedding every 3-4 weeks.

If your snake looks health, eats regularly and is active, I wouldn't worry. :)
 
shedding time

My juvy corn took a while on her first shed. Even though color was starting to fade, fed 3 pinkies on 4/19. That was last feed until 5/3. It took about a week for eyes to blue and another 4-5 days after they cleared for the shed on 5/1. The entire time rarely left hide. That was first shed since bought on 3/22/03. She is 18-20" and am now feeding 1 fuzzy/wk since 3 pinkies were no problem. Really tried my patience waiting to see if everything went OK.
